Marketing Beverage Funding Financial Analyst

Responsible for performing essential accounting and analytical duties related to the Jack in the Box Marketing Fund and Beverage Funding including collaborating with internal departments in developing the Marketing Fund budget and forecast. Performs accounting duties related to GL close of Marketing Fund and Beverage Funding involving SOX process and controls, projects, account reconciliations, and financial or statistical analysis to support decision making by Supply Chain and Marketing leadership.

KEY D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Oversees and reviews beverage contract agreements; performs analysis to prepare journal entries and posts to the general ledger; performs short and long-term liability account reconciliation, identifies inaccuracies/variances, and researches/resolves discrepancies. Estimates prepaid funds to transfer to converted franchised restaurants. Liaison between vendors and JIB regarding beverage funding and ensures effective on-going relationship.

  • Evaluates and calculates cost of beverage inventory for Company operations; prepares journal entry and posts to the general ledger.

  • Creates reports and downloads data to produce spreadsheets and tables for reporting purposes. Performs quarterly and annual reconciliations with beverage vendors, identifies inaccuracies/variances, researches and resolves discrepancies. Prepares Sarbanes-Oxley (SOX) reporting package for beverage funding reconciliation. Provides flux analysis for beverage accounts.

  • Maintains store count report used for Marketing Fund and Beverage Funding. Maintains SOX process compliance and marketing fund objectives. Maintains Jack in the Box Oracle Project module for Marketing Fund.

  • Assists in preparing presentations of Marketing Fund results and related information for the internal Marketing organization.

  • Collects and tracks inventory donations for quarterly tax purposes. Tracks, reconciles, and disperses vendor rebates.

  • Coordinates and facilitates the development of the Marketing Fund budget and forecast. Analyzes submissions from departments for compliance with Marketing Fund objectives and interprets trends to address misalignments, if any.

  • Develops detailed budget and forecast for Regional Marketing Advertising to Sales (A/S) forecast at market level each fiscal period. Monitors planned regional media placement to ensure spend meets placement targets and communication goals specified for markets.

  • Acts as the accounting liaison for marketing and supply chain departments to ensure the marketing fund is accurately reflecting the planned spend. Performs analysis to identify and communicate large variances in data.

  • Performs period end General Ledger close duties related to the Marketing Fund; prepares journal entries and posts to the general ledger; performs liability and prepaid account reconciliations, identifies inaccuracies/variances, researches and resolves discrepancies. Prepares Sarbanes-Oxley (SOX) reporting package for marketing fund reconciliation. Provides flux analysis for Marketing Fund balance sheet accounts.

  • Reconciles period end reporting of Oracle Projects to the General Ledger. Provides Period end reporting to Marketing groups.

  • Assists the preparation and distribution of monthly, quarterly, and annual status reports for the Jack in the Box Inc. marketing organizations.

  • Coordinates with multiple departments to ensure accurate coding of checks and wires.

QUALIFICATIONS:

Education

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Economics or Finance.

Experience

  • 3-4 years related accounting/financial analyst experience.

Skills/Knowledge/Abilities

  • Proficient knowledge of accounting concepts and techniques.

  • Solid computer skills, including proficient knowledge of Excel; working knowledge of accounting and financial systems preferred (Oracle/Discoverer, Hyperion).

  • Strong oral and written English communication skills and interpersonal skills.

  • Requires strong organization, accuracy, and attention to detail.

  • Demonstrates integrity and ethical behavior.

Physical Requirements

  • Ability to speak/hear clearly in person and on the telephone, ability to operate a personal computer. Ability to operate a 10-key by touch.

The range for this position is $63,700 - $90,700 and is based on an employee located at our corporate headquarters in San Diego. If the candidate is hired in a different city to work remote, we will apply a geographic pay differential based on the cost of labor in the market in which the employee resides.
